Product Description
A thriller and spy novel. The nine aircraft flew over the city around six thirty in the afternoon. The citizens suffered more than two hours of the longest bombing of the entire war. The enemy's order was to cause maximum damage, and many residents were burned to death by fire or strafed by fighter planes. Dozens of bodies were strewn on otherwise peaceful city streets. The blaze burned was out of control. Within hours, the historical capital of the Basque town Gernika was flattened--a dead city.In April 1937, former police commissioner Alfonso Ros is required by the high command to investigate the suspicious death of Damian von Veltheim, captain of the Legion sent by Hitler to help win the war. Among the intrigue, political conspiracies, and double agents, Alfonso conducts his investigation, accompanied by German Lieutenant Raymond Maurer and enigmatic Italian Delilah. Along the way, he discovers that he is not investigating murder in Spain during a bloody war, but an international conspiracy, which if successful would change the course of history as we know it--and which many are determined to continue hiding from the world at any price.Una novela policiaca y de espias.
